Hyaluronic Acid: Exploring Its Properties and Applications

Hyaluronic acid is a naturally occurring molecule found in various tissues throughout the human body. It plays a vital role in maintaining skin hydration. Due to its exceptional ability to absorb and retain water, hyaluronic acid creates a protective barrier on the skin's top, keeping it soft.

  • Besides its role in skin health, hyaluronic acid also has applications inBeyond skin care, hyaluronic acid finds use inIn addition to its benefits for the skin, hyaluronic acid is valuable for
  • managing osteoarthritis symptoms
  • tissue regeneration
  • eye health

Studies are ongoing to understand the diverse applications of hyaluronic acid, promising revolutionary medical advancements in the future.

Hyaluronic Acid's Anti-Aging Effects: A Scientific Look

Hyaluronic acid is widely known for its remarkable ability to combat the appearance of wrinkles. This naturally occurring substance is found in our bodies, primarily in the skin, where it functions as a humectant, meaning it holds onto moisture. As we age, our natural hyaluronic acid production reduces. This leads to the skin becoming dehydrated, which promotes the formation of wrinkles and fine lines.

External hyaluronic acid creams restore the skin's moisture levels, plumping the appearance of wrinkles and boosting overall skin appearance.

  • Additionally, hyaluronic acid also encourages collagen production, which provides to the skin's elasticity and reduces the appearance of wrinkles.
  • Clinical trials have shown that hyaluronic acid can effectively minimize the depth and prominence of wrinkles, leading to a more youthful and radiant complexion.
